Wilderness Villas to Kouzzina on Disney Transportation

You can take a bus or the boat over to MK and then hop on a Boardwalk bus from there.
 
There are several options but you can
1. Take a bus to AK, studios or Downtown Disney and transfer to a Boardwalk bus.
2. Take the water craft to MK and then take a bus to boardwalk.
 
Or if its a nice day, take the bus to DHS, and then walk to the Boardwalk. Maybe a 15 minute walk. Or if you are in Epcot, you can walk over from the International Gateway. It all depends on where you are going to be that day.
Or you could take the Friendship boat from either location instead of walking.

It's right about the consistancy of Ohana's but check out the firework schedule at MK for the night and try to book 1 hour or less before the fireworks. When you get to the podium request a window seat. At the time of the fireworks they will lower the lights and play music. Sometimes it takes a liitle atmosphere to make the food taste better.
